The phrase in question originates from Italian and, literally rendered, means “I will fly for you.” It represents a declaration of profound devotion and willingness to undertake significant endeavors, potentially even impossible ones, for the sake of a loved one. As a verbal expression, it signifies an unwavering commitment, exceeding typical acts of service.
The inherent value in such a sentiment lies in its potent conveyance of love and dedication. Its historical context is embedded in romantic traditions, often found in operatic arias and popular music, where the expression of intense emotion is paramount. The phrase transcends linguistic boundaries, resonating with individuals who appreciate the power of selfless acts and unwavering support.

Question 1: What is the precise meaning of the Italian phrase “translate por ti volare”?
The literal translation of “translate por ti volare” is “I will fly for you.” However, its intended meaning extends beyond a literal interpretation, signifying an unwavering willingness to undertake extraordinary endeavors, even those deemed impossible, for the sake of a cherished individual.
Question 2: Is “translate por ti volare” a commonly used expression in modern Italian?
While the sentiment is readily understood, the specific phrasing might not be encountered in everyday modern Italian conversation. The expression carries a somewhat dramatic and romantic tone, making it more likely to appear in artistic contexts, such as opera or popular music, rather than in casual discourse.
